Posted November 14, 200222 yr comment_18955 i hooked up my exhuast yesterday without the muffler, its 2 1/4 inch piping all the way back, no smog stuff, i hacksawed off my other muffler cause my apexi N1 is gonna be welded on by my friend, im just wondering if its gonna be too loud for the week or two till i get my muffler on, has anybody ran there 240 like this? November 14, 200222 yr comment_19027 Mike,The sound of an inline 4 motorcycle engine hitting close to the rev-limiter is entirely different than a Harley chugging down the road w/ straight pipes.My personal favorite (for bikes) is the old KZ1000's when they come on the cam at about 9000 rpm. Beautiful sound.Btw, anybody want to know why Harleys "lope" at idle? It's actually a carburated backfire through the single carb. A glitch in the carb system of all things. When Harley first put out their fuel injected bikes, they were quiet and ran smoothly. So to keep w/ their "heritage", the engineers re-programmed the injection maps to incorporate a miss or mis-fire actually, so the characteristic Harley sound could further be enjoyed. What a joke....
